    The biggest problem with the RAF (22 years as an Armourer, so I've seen this in practice) is that, as the youngest of the three branches of Service, the RAF has the most corporate mindset. There's always someone (usually at the mid-management level) who is quick to jump on board with terms like Lean and Total Quality Analysis and the 6S system (is it still 6 or have they found a seventh S). Whilst in practice they are useful, all too often they become a goal to be achieved at the cost of everything else, up to and including primary tasking.
